Output ebf4aaf2573733b7577d474f1e167cb76838c7dd3a6cffc58cc61a6c596bee89:4

value
770218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ea0d39b4c805e1f3f43186446b525681c55293a OP_EQUAL
address
3EhAYDBrAHoPKpAumfj3zuwcKCsy2YZt9C
transaction
ebf4aaf2573733b7577d474f1e167cb76838c7dd3a6cffc58cc61a6c596bee89
confirmations
221722
spent
true